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32 5619567415 4076303
89781162 68029 844
89781162 68029 844
73 431601 13 92386 259803271
All about undefined
Interested in learning more?
89781162 68029 844
73 431601 13 92386 259803271
See more
0083188 461848014 20875579651
89 848 24 83
See more
68228685 710777123
74039408 4474 3568 936402 51
See more